What is MyNetDiary App?

MyNetDiary is a mobile (IOS, Android) app calorie and exercise tracker that helps people become more healthy, more active and lose weight. It has over 18 million members worldwide. Its target audience is women 20-50 years old, overweight. The rest is male, 30-50 years old, overweight.

MyNetDiary was founded in 2005, it is a private company (MyNetDiary.Inc.) headquartered in Marlton, NJ. and it claims to be the most comprehensive, accurate, and user-friendly diet app in App Store and Google Play. Like Omega XL previously reviewed, MyNetDiary claims to be effective.

How MyNetDiary Works

  • MyNetDiary takes the guesswork out of figuring how many calories you need each day to maintain your weight loss. 
  • The app adjusts the Food Calorie Budget when your weight goes up or down.
  • Tap “My Weight Plan” (from Dashboard) to adjust your plan.

Pros

  • Calorie Tracking: MyNetDiary simplifies calorie counting by deducting calories from your daily budget, ensuring you remain aware of your consumption.
  • Food Grading: The app assigns grades from A to D to tracked foods, facilitating identification of unhealthy choices and promoting healthier alternatives.
  • Activity Tracking: Beyond food, the app accommodates logging of exercise-induced calorie burn. Data import from other fitness apps is feasible.

Cons: Side Effects Of This Product

As calorie counting focuses more on quantity of food, some people may therefore forget about food quality. Reaching macronutrient and daily energy goals may come at a price of quality deficit. The error rate of tracking calories is high, especially when it comes to selecting appropriate food substitutes.
